The Trapper Flat to Birch Creek stretch of Panther Creek in Idaho is 8 miles long and is according to American Whitewater a class III-V section of whitewater. QUICK STATS
AW Class: III-V
Length: 8 miles
  
Putin Location Coordinates:
Latitude: 45.16611
Longitude: -114.29751

Takeout Location Coordinates:
Latitude: 45.27166
Longitude: -114.34
